Poverty Headcount reduction (%) - Contributory Pensions - 1st quintile (poorest) -urban by country
Poverty headcount reduction due to Contributory Pensions programs as % of pre-transfer poverty headcount
What the numbers show
Poverty Headcount reduction (%) - Contributory Pensions - 1st quintile (poorest) -urban is currently reported for 32 countries. The highest value is 58.9% in Serbia; the lowest is 2.2% in Honduras.
The median across all reporting countries is 19.1%, and the mean is 26.8%.
The gap between the highest and lowest reporting country is a factor of about 26.
Over the past decade 24 countries rose and 8 fell. The largest increase was in Colombia (up 116.4%), and the largest decrease in Cote d'Ivoire (down 59.7%).
Poverty Headcount reduction (%) - Contributory Pensions - 1st quintil: full country ranking
| # | Country | Latest | Year | 10-year change | Trend |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Serbia | 58.9% | 2022 | up 7.2% | flat |
| 2 | Belarus | 56.7% | 2019 | up 21.4% | rising |
| 3 | Poland | 56.5% | 2019 | up 1.8% | falling |
| 4 | Romania | 55.1% | 2021 | down 2.8% | flat |
| 5 | Ukraine | 55.1% | 2020 | up 1.3% | flat |
| 6 | Moldova | 53.7% | 2018 | up 37.2% | rising |
| 7 | Armenia | 52.9% | 2022 | up 14.1% | rising |
| 8 | Kazakhstan | 48.1% | 2021 | up 93.2% | rising |
| 9 | Kyrgyzstan | 47.5% | 2020 | up 10.5% | rising |
| 10 | Mongolia | 43.5% | 2020 | up 43.4% | rising |
| 11 | Turkey | 40.9% | 2019 | up 15.4% | rising |
| 12 | Uruguay | 40.4% | 2022 | up 13.4% | rising |
| 13 | Argentina | 29.4% | 2022 | up 15.5% | rising |
| 14 | Brazil | 29.1% | 2022 | down 16.6% | falling |
| 15 | Costa Rica | 21.9% | 2022 | up 48.3% | rising |
| 16 | Chile | 21.5% | 2022 | up 10.1% | falling |
| 17 | Thailand | 16.8% | 2021 | up 26.7% | rising |
| 18 | Vietnam | 15.7% | 2020 | up 31.0% | falling |
| 19 | Panama | 15.6% | 2023 | up 3.7% | rising |
| 20 | Mexico | 15.5% | 2022 | up 14.0% | rising |
| 21 | Sri Lanka | 10.9% | 2019 | up 10.6% | rising |
| 22 | Ecuador | 10.1% | 2022 | down 36.2% | falling |
| 23 | Pakistan | 9.6% | 2018 | up 20.5% | rising |
| 24 | Colombia | 9.3% | 2022 | up 116.4% | rising |
| 25 | Bolivia | 7.4% | 2021 | down 19.0% | rising |
| 26 | South Africa | 7.0% | 2021 | up 48.3% | rising |
| 27 | Dominican Republic | 6.9% | 2021 | up 22.8% | rising |
| 28 | Peru | 5.7% | 2022 | down 21.0% | falling |
| 29 | Paraguay | 4.9% | 2022 | down 19.6% | falling |
| 30 | Cote d'Ivoire | 4.1% | 2021 | down 59.7% | volatile |
| 31 | El Salvador | 3.3% | 2022 | down 55.7% | falling |
| 32 | Honduras | 2.2% | 2019 | up 5.0% | falling |
